Q.

how much of milk is sufficient for 3 years old child in a day?TIA

A. Hello mom Now your baby it’s years old and if your baby is taking 300 ML milk in a day that is more than enough. Rather than this baby should take at least four meals in a day and maintain a diet plan according to that.
